Flood Watch issued September 16 at 2:55PM EDT until September 17 at 2:00PM EDT by NWS Wilmington OH (details ...)
* WHAT...Flash flooding caused by excessive rainfall is possible. * WHERE...Portions of east central Indiana, including the following county, Wayne and Ohio, including the following counties, Auglaize, Champaign, Clark, Darke, Delaware, Franklin, Greene, Hardin, Licking, Logan, Madison, Mercer, Miami, Montgomery, Preble, Shelby and Union. * WHEN...From midnight EDT tonight through Thursday afternoon. * IMPACTS...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ers, cre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ations. * ADDITIONAL DETAILS... - Multiple rounds of rain will occur overnight into Thursday. The heavier bands of rainfall will have 2 to 4 inches with locally higher amounts.
Scott Frey, executive director of the Southwestern Auglaize County Chamber of Commerce since August 2009, has resigned.
Frey tendered his resignation to the chamber's board of directors on Monday, saying he accepted a business position with a local company. His resignation is effective March 24. [More]
CELINA - Three new cruisers soon will be added to the sheriff's fleet of 29 vehicles.
Mercer County Commissioners this week approved action by sheriff Jeff Grey to purchase one unmarked and two marked vehicles. Each of the three 2014 Ford Utility Police Interceptors costs approximately $25,650.
